
Late Bronze Age II
White Slip II Globular Bowl
Pottery White Slip II globular bowl with everted rim and round base; hand-made; single small vertical loop handle with concave outer face low on shoulder; decorated in matt brown paint with horizontal wavy lines and dots in imitation of scale pattern on upper body, lower body with five evenly spaced vertical wavy lines framed by dots to base with row single or double hatched lozenges between; single festoon with dots on rim interior; red clay with thick, slightly lustrous pale yellowish slip; large chip from rim and hole in body. Dimensions: Diameter: 21.40 centimetres; Height: 15.50 centimetres Object Type: bowl Ware: White Slip Ware (Cypriot) Series: White Slip II Techniques: painted; handmade; slipped
